The projection of spinal neurons to the lateral reticular nucleus of the rat was investigated with a non-fluorescent double retrograde tracing technique. Either a gold-lectin tracer or cholera toxin-b-subunit was injected into the lateral reticular nucleus on each side of the brain. cutaneous metaplastic synovial cyst (cmsc), presents as a solitary, tender subcutaneous nodule that usually occurs at the site of previous surgery or trauma. histologically, the lesion is characterized by a cystic structure with villous-like projections that lined by metaplastic synovial tissue. the main cause remains unclear, but trauma is presumed to be a precipitating factor, as most reporte...
